Value readout
Where each school has the edge
Southern Arkansas University Main Campus costs $3,400 more per year than Arkansas Baptist College ($14,027 vs $10,627). Southern Arkansas University Main Campus graduates report $13,968 higher median earnings after ten years ($42,386 vs $28,418). On EduGradify's model that puts Southern Arkansas University Main Campus ahead on projected ROI (7.55 vs 6.69, exceptional investment).
The pricier option (Southern Arkansas University Main Campus) still wins on return, because stronger graduate salaries outweigh its higher net price. On admissions, Southern Arkansas University Main Campus reports 75.3% acceptance; Arkansas Baptist College does not report a standard acceptance rate in the current federal data.

Is Arkansas Baptist College or Southern Arkansas University Main Campus the better value?
Southern Arkansas University Main Campus has the higher EduGradify ROI score (7.55 vs 6.69), meaning its ten-year earnings go further against its net price.
Which school costs less after aid?
Arkansas Baptist College is cheaper — average net price $10,627 per year vs $14,027 at Southern Arkansas University Main Campus. The annual difference of $3,400 adds up to about $13,600 over four years.
Which school reports higher earnings?
Southern Arkansas University Main Campus reports higher median earnings ten years after entry: $42,386 vs $28,418 at Arkansas Baptist College. The annual gap in the federal data is $13,968.
